USDA home loans are made possible by the U.S. Department of Agriculture. USDA loans are for home buyers in eligible rural areas of the country and are intended to help promote homeownership in those areas. That’s why this type of loan is also known as the usda rural development loan (RD Loan).

USDA Base Loan Amount-This is the amount of your loan after subtracting your down payment from the total, but prior to adding in the USDA upfront mortgage insurance premium (UPMIP). USDA Upfront Mortgage Insurance – All USDA loans require a 2.00% upfront mortgage insurance premium to be paid.

Conventional Loan Limits Texas Updated 2019 texas conforming loan limits: fha, VA, & Conventional. Conforming loan limits for 2019. The conforming loan limit is rising to $484,350. That’s $31,250 higher than 2018’s limit. This is the third year in a row loan limits have increased after ten years of no movement.
